Why Denark?

Performance as Construction Manager At-Risk

Our emphasis on professional Preconstruction Services has led to reliable and consistent budgets, detailed value management, avoiding change orders and controlling costs throughout the project. In fact, our Change Order % for CM At-Risk projects is typically less than half a percent!

Tenure of Team

The average tenure of a Denark Operations Team Member is more than 15 years. The industry average is 4 years. Our people are always our most valuable asset. Therefore, we take care of our Team, our Team takes care of our Clients, and in turn our Clients trust us with repeat business. This circle of success has resulted in 70% repeat business.

Consistent On-Time Completion

We are committed to delivering on every promise made, especially as it relates to completing projects on-time. We are proud of the fact that Denark has never been assessed liquidated damages on a project in its history.

Financial Strength

Due to our firm’s significant net worth and working capital, this project will enjoy the security of a strong financial base and ample bonding capacity.

Safety Excellence

As evidenced by our EMR, safety record, Governor’s Award of Excellence from TOSHA, and national recognition as one of “America’s Safest Companies” by EHS Today, safety is ingrained in Denark’s culture.

Extensive Network of Local, Regional, and National Partners

In addition to a deep-rooted local presence, our regional and national experience has resulted in strong relationships among countless subcontractors and suppliers, large and small.

2023 Pinnacle Award

Denark was honored to receive the Knoxville Chamber‘s Pinnacle Impact Award in 2023. The award is presented to a non-charitable business that displays a commitment to making East Tennessee a better place to live through the development and support of a community project or program. Giving Back

Since its inception, Denark has proven to be a leader in corporate philanthropy and civic engagement. Despite having fewer than 100 Team Members, our company has consistently ranked in the Top 25 among all businesses and corporations for United Way giving since 2014. In any given year, Denark supports and participates in more than 75 different programs, initiatives, or events for a variety of community organizations.

Our rationale for investment is not transactional. “Giving back” is part of our company’s mission and we consider it a cultural value throughout Denark. Our community has helped us be successful; therefore, it is our responsibility to help the community be successful. We support programs, projects, and policies that help make the Knoxville area a great place for our company to thrive and for our Team Members to live, work, play, and raise their families.
